Database 关于日期的数据库的第二标准形式

Database 关于日期的数据库的第二标准形式,database,sqlite,relational-database,normalization,Database,Sqlite,Relational Database,Normalization,在对数据库进行规范化处理后,我意识到,尽管我可以将日期等信息存储在自己的表中,使用唯一ID标识每个日期,并在连接表中使用唯一ID,我仍然需要重复数据和额外的存储要求,这会给系统带来更大的压力 我的问题是,即使日期、重量等可能会重复很多次,无论我如何存储它,它是否仍然会因为依赖主键而算作2NF,据我所知,如果不允许重复数据,那么任何数据库都不会达到2NF,更不用说第三个了 谢谢 JHB92为什么你认为重复的日期值违反了规则?这是如何向我解释的,但是在阅读了你的定义后,我发现它没有违反规则!

在对数据库进行规范化处理后,我意识到,尽管我可以将日期等信息存储在自己的表中,使用唯一ID标识每个日期,并在连接表中使用唯一ID,我仍然需要重复数据和额外的存储要求,这会给系统带来更大的压力

我的问题是,即使日期、重量等可能会重复很多次,无论我如何存储它,它是否仍然会因为依赖主键而算作2NF,据我所知,如果不允许重复数据,那么任何数据库都不会达到2NF,更不用说第三个了

谢谢


JHB92

为什么你认为重复的日期值违反了规则?这是如何向我解释的,但是在阅读了你的定义后,我发现它没有违反规则!